The Power of NMN and Resveratrol What is NMN and How Does it Promote Healthspan? NMN is a naturally occurring compound that plays a crucial role in the production of NAD+ (Nicotinamide Adenine Dinucleotide), a molecule essential for energy production within cells. As we age, our NAD+ levels decline, leading to decreased energy, slower metabolism, and a weakened ability to repair cells. Supplementing with NMN helps restore NAD+ levels, boosting cellular function, energy production, and overall vitality. Benefits of NMN: Improved energy production Enhanced cellular repair and regeneration Support for healthy metabolism Understanding the Benefits of Resveratrol Resveratrol is a powerful antioxidant found in foods like red wine, grapes, and certain berries. Known for its ability to reduce inflammation and promote heart health, resveratrol also supports longevity by activating genes involved in cell repair and regeneration. What Makes Reduced Glutathione Powder Different?

图片
Unique Chemical Structure Reduced glutathione powder differs chemically from its oxidized counterpart. Key features include: Active thiol group for antioxidant activity Ability to neutralize free radicals efficiently Stable under controlled conditions Readily absorbed by cells The reduced form ensures maximum bioavailability and therapeutic effects, which is why manufacturers focus on high-quality production. Antioxidant Properties The primary function of reduced glutathione powder is its antioxidant activity. It neutralizes reactive oxygen species (ROS) and protects cells from damage. Advantages include: Protects DNA and cellular membranes Reduces oxidative stress in the body Supports liver detoxification processes Maintains immune system balance Regular supplementation can support overall health and longevity by reducing cellular wear and tear.
